Duct Airflow Velocity Calculator
Calculate the air velocity inside a duct given the volumetric flow rate and duct cross-sectional dimensions (rectangular or circular).
Formula
V = Q / A
- V = Air velocity (FPM — feet per minute)
- Q = Volumetric flow rate (CFM — cubic feet per minute)
- A = Duct cross-sectional area (ft²)
Circular duct area: A = (π / 4) × d²
Rectangular duct area: A = W × H
Dimensions in inches are divided by 144 to convert in² → ft².
Unit conversion: 1 FPM = 0.00508 m/s
Assumptions & References
- Recommended velocity range of 500–2,500 FPM is based on ASHRAE Fundamentals Handbook (Chapter 21 — Duct Design) for low-velocity HVAC supply ductwork.
